Double-Blind Technique
A method used in research where neither the participants nor the experimenters know who is receiving a particular treatment, reducing bias.
Conceptual Replications
Replications of studies using different methods or measures to verify the underlying concept or hypothesis.
Random Sample
A subset of individuals chosen from a larger set (population) where each individual has an equal chance of being selected.
Nonequivalent Groups
Groups in an experimental design that are not created equal, often due to the absence of random assignment.
